Women's Basketball: Muskingum (1-11 Overall, 0-5 OAC) at Ohio Northern (7-5 Overall, 1-4 OAC)
Saturday, January 5, 2019, 3 p.m. - ONU Sports Center, Ada, Ohio
Saturday's Game Notes: The Ohio Northern women's basketball program opens the 2019 calendar year Saturday afternoon as the Polar Bears host OAC foe Muskingum inside the ONU Sports Center ... Tipoff is set for 3 p.m. in Ada ... The Orange and Black will enter the contest sporting a 7-5 overall mark and a 1-4 record against the conference loop ... Northern recently battled to a 1-1 record at the D3hoops.com Classic in Las Vegas, Nevada over the holiday break, besting Carthage (Wisc.) 65-57 and falling to Willamette (Ore.) 43-41 ... Junior guard Abby Weeks led the Polar Bears with 13.0 points per contest over the two-game span and dished out a team-high four assists ... Meanwhile, sophomore guard Emily Brock and senior guard Alyssa Manley chipped in 14 and 10 points, respectively, in the opening contest, fueling a late 13-0 run to defeat Carthage ... Through 12 games this season, senior guard Jenna Dirksen leads Ohio Northern with 14.1 points per game, which ranks sixth on the OAC leaderboards ... Junior center Emily Mescher tops the program with 6.8 rebounds per game while senior Tori Wyss trails closely with 6.4 boards per outing ... Mescher ranks eighth in the conference with a 52% field goal percentage, giving her a 55.8% career clip to top the school record books ... Brock also stands among the league's best, standing seventh in three-point field goal percentage with a 42.6% conversion rate ... Muskingum enters their first contest in 2019 sporting a 1-11 overall record and a 0-5 mark in the Ohio Athletic Conference ... The Muskies dropped their last contest 100-61 at OAC foe Marietta on Saturday, December 29 ... Junior forward Devyn Bonner and sophomore guard Emiy Yeager are each averaging 12.9 points per game to lead the Muskingum offense ... The former also tops the team with 6.3 rebounds per outing while the latter paces the team with 2.2 assists per contest.

All-Time Series: The Polar Bears currently own a 44-39 all-time series advantage over the Muskies, which includes a 24-13 record when defending home court ... ONU has won the last 15 matchups between the two programs ... Northern swept last season's series, defeating Muskingum 70-36 inside the ONU Sports Center while winning 73-66 on the road.
ONU Head Coach Michele Durand: Durand is now in her 18th season at the helm of the Ohio Northern women's basketball program and currently sports a 305-168 record, a winning percentage of .645 ... She currently stands as the all-time winningest coach in program history.
